Java 8 - 自定义Collector
PreCollector 接口包含了一系列方法,为实现具体的归约操作(即收集器)提供了范本。我们已经看过了 Collector 接口中实现的许多收集器,例如 toList 或 groupingBy 。这也意味着可以为 Collector 接口提供自己的实现,从而自由地创建自定义归约操作。要开始使用 Collector 接口,我们先看看toList 工厂方法,它会把流中的所有元素收集成一个 Lis....

盘点Java中的那些常用的Garbage Collector
GC总览Java是一门面向对象的语言。在使用Java的过程中,会创建大量的对象在内存中。而这些对象,需要在用完之后“回收”掉,释放内存资源。这件事我们称它为垃圾收集(Garbage Collection,简称GC),而实际执行者就是各种各样的“垃圾收集器”(Garbage Collector,以下也简称GC)。为什么会有各种各样的GC?因为时代在发展,以前的GC可能不能满足现在的需求,所以就会有....

Java8 Stream 自定义Collector
在之前的例子中,我们都是使用Collectors的静态方法提供的CollectorImpl,为接口Collector的一个实现类,为了自定义我们自己的Collector,先来分析一下Collector接口。一、分析接口Collector/** * @param <T> 要收集的元素的泛型 * @param <A> 累加器容器的类型, * @param <R&g...

怎么在java中创建一个自定义的collector
目录简介Collector介绍自定义Collector总结怎么在java中创建一个自定义的collector简介在之前的java collectors文章里面,我们讲到了stream的collect方法可以调用Collectors里面的toList()或者toMap()方法,将结果转换为特定的集合类。今天我们介绍一下怎么自定义一个Collector。Collector介绍我们先看一下Collec....

请问在Java性能优化中垃圾回收Garbage First (G1) Collector关注什么?
请问在Java性能优化中垃圾回收Garbage First (G1) Collector关注什么?
Java8-理解Collector
上一节学习了Java8中比较常用的内置collector的用法。接下来就来理解下collector的组成。 Collector定义 Collector接口包含了一系列方法,为实现具体的归约操作(即收集器)提供了范本。我们已经看过了Collector接口中实现的许多收集器,例如toList或groupingBy。这也意味着你可以为Collector接口提供自己的实现,从而自由创建自定义归约操作。 ....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Java开发者
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~
+关注